How To Install JTR on a Mac. John The Ripper is a cracking password program, also known as JTR or john. John The Ripper is not for the beginner, and does NOT crack WPA (alone) (by itself) (solely). You must be able to use Terminal, there is no GUI. Read the Terminal notes at the end This is a pre-compiled install. If you wish to install from scratch, you'll need Xcode. This Pre-compiled install is not the best per se, by default John The Ripper is 'Single Core'on this version, and does not always includes the latest patches.

You can pipe an output of JTR into Aircrack, See -stdout and/or -incremental on the JTR wiki Benchmark This Benchmark was done using the same 2.5 GHz Dual Core, using 3 different build of John The Ripper, each time Single/Dual Core mode, the test was 5 sec for a Raw SHA1 hash./john -test=5 5 sec for each benchmark instead of the 1 sec default value JTR OSX Build Single Core Benchmarking: dynamic26: sha1($p) raw-sha1 4x2.

Notes Cracking Speed The Cracking speed will highly depend on the quality of your Wordlist, the default file password.lst located in./John/run is not the best.

Check also the -rules option Of course, having a multi-core build (x2, x4, etc) will greatly help Terminal Notes The FTP has a short timeout: Don't go away for too long or you'll be kicked out and will have to restart from scratch. If you are kicked out too many times, you'll end up blacklisted for few hours. You must be logged as 'anonymous' If your path is a bit long, rename the directory.

You can always drag the files into Terminal, that will save some typing. John The Ripper Best Practices - As you type the path and names, avoid long and complex names for files and directories - Place your files either in /Run or on the Desktop - You can always drag and drop the files into Terminal, that will save some typing. (it's a repeat, just in case you've missed it ) - Create a Session, if you need to stop the cracking, you can always re-start where you left, and not from scratch. 1) Create a Session and give it a NAME, example 'Likedin' and indicate the file containing the Hashes to be cracked.With- Path if necessary. 'crackme.txt' being the file containing the hashes to be cracked. Guesses: 0 time: 0:00:00:01 2.59% (ETA: Wed Jun 13 16:) c/s: 197606K trying: B62608 - BABARO6 ETA is the ESTIMATED time of arrival c/s: 'The values displayed by John mean combinations (of username and password) per second, not crypts per second. This is the effective cracking speed that you get on a particular set of password hashes ' www.openwall.com here: 197,606,000 John The Ripper Tutorial and Quick Tips John The Ripper Known Bugs Crash Recovery File is Locked When quitting John or interrupting a session, use CTRL-C and NOT CTRL-Z Using CTRL-Z will leave a process running.

If you have multiple process running you'll get this error. You can kill / check those processes in Activity Monitor.
